Practice for multiplayer
If you have little multiplayer experience in shooter games, there is no shame in practicing anything beforehand.
- Battlefield 4 provides you with a fully equipped test site. You can find this in the Battlelog under the tab Multiplayer.
- All vehicles are available to you on the test site. There are also targets. On the practice area, you can improve your skills before the big multiplayer battle begins.
The right loadout for the Battlefield
Before you even go to a server, you should take a look at your loadouts. You can find this in the Battlelog. There you can see the four classes and all available vehicles.
- Before starting the battle, think about what equipment you want to use. So if you prefer to equip your medic with an AK rather than a SCAR, you can set this in the loadouts.
- Vehicle bonuses can also be changed in this way. You are well prepared for the next battle.
Be a member of a squad
Once you have found your way to a server, it is important to play in a team.
- Depending on the number of players, your team is divided into several squads. You can decide who you want to be in a squad with. The advantage: Squad members can spawn together.
- In addition, as long as at least one squad member is alive, you will unlock bonuses for your unit to help you fight. So be a team player.
Be kind
What is self-evident for many is a hurdle for others: friendliness
- Always adhere to the server rules, avoid baserapes and deliberate team kills. You should also not steal vehicles from your own team members. This leads to frustration and distrust in the team.
- Good manners in text and voice chat are also recommended. This will make the game more fun and you will not be kicked or banned by any server.
Familiarize yourself with the gameplay
If you haven't played a Battlefield part yet, the game will first seem a bit confusing and complicated. Take your time, for example on the test site, to get to know the gameplay better.
- Also try to specialize in one class at the beginning, for example the medic, and get to know your weapons better: How high is the recoil or how many shots do I have? With a little practice, you will soon no longer have any problems at the front.
